Blaine's Coastal Climate Is Hard on Siding

Blaine sits close enough to the water that homes here deal with a version of weather most of the country never sees: salt-laden air off the Strait of Georgia and Semiahmoo Bay, wind-driven rain that hits walls sideways instead of falling straight down, and a gray, wet stretch from late fall through spring where surfaces rarely get a chance to fully dry. Add in the shade from mature evergreens on a lot of Whatcom County properties, and you've got the exact conditions that grow moss and algae on siding faster than almost anywhere else in the state.

None of that is exotic information to anyone who's lived here a while. But it matters a lot when you're choosing what material goes on the outside of your house, because siding that performs fine in a dry inland climate can struggle in this one. Salt air accelerates corrosion on fasteners and trim. Driving rain finds every gap in flashing and caulk that a calmer climate would forgive. And moss doesn't just look bad — trapped moisture underneath it is what actually damages siding over time.

James Hardie's fiber cement is cement, sand, and cellulose fibers, engineered and cured to be dimensionally stable and non-combustible. It doesn't absorb water the way wood-based products can, it doesn't swell or delaminate at cut edges the way some engineered wood products can when moisture gets in, and it holds its factory finish for a long time instead of needing to be repainted every several years. For a home taking on salt air and near-constant winter dampness, that stability is the whole point.

The HZ5 Product Line

James Hardie makes climate-specific versions of its siding, and the HZ5 line is engineered for the Pacific Northwest's wet, moderate climate — the moisture and freeze-thaw exposure common in Whatcom County. It's the line we specify for Blaine and Ferndale homes rather than a generic product designed for a drier region. That distinction matters more here than in most parts of the country, because the difference between siding rated for your actual weather and siding that just happens to be sold nearby shows up in how long it lasts.

What a Correct Installation Actually Involves

Good siding material installed poorly will still fail in this climate, usually faster than people expect. Most siding problems we get called out to inspect in this area aren't material failures — they're installation shortcuts that let water in behind the siding, where it does its damage out of sight. A correct James Hardie install in a coastal wind-and-rain environment includes:

  • A properly lapped weather-resistive barrier behind the siding, with all penetrations (pipes, vents, hose bibs) flashed and sealed before a single board goes up
  • Correct fastener type and spacing — Hardie specifies this precisely, and it's not the same as framing nailer defaults
  • Proper clearance at the bottom of the siding from grade, decks, and roof lines, so water has somewhere to go instead of wicking up into the board
  • Butt joints and corners sealed and flashed to shed wind-driven rain rather than just relying on caulk alone
  • Factory-cut and factory-primed edges kept intact wherever possible, with any field cuts properly sealed with Hardie-approved products
  • Corrosion-resistant fasteners and trim hardware, given the salt air this close to the water

Skip any one of these and you can end up with siding that looks fine from the street for a couple of years while moisture is already working on the sheathing behind it. That's the failure mode we're most careful to prevent.

Moss, Algae, and Long-Term Appearance

Blaine's tree cover and damp season create ideal conditions for moss and algae growth on north-facing and shaded walls. James Hardie's ColorPlus factory finish is baked on under controlled conditions and holds color and sheen better than field-applied paint, which helps growth show up less and makes cleaning easier when it does appear. But finish quality doesn't eliminate the need for basic maintenance — siding in a moss-prone spot still benefits from an occasional gentle rinse and keeping nearby vegetation trimmed back so walls get some air and light.

What correct installation and a factory finish do prevent is the deeper problem: moisture trapped against the substrate under moss or algae growth. On materials prone to swelling or rot, that's where real damage starts. On properly installed Hardie siding, the surface growth stays a cosmetic issue instead of a structural one.

Comparing Materials for a Coastal Whatcom County Home

FactorJames Hardie Fiber CementVinylWood / Engineered Wood
Moisture resistance in driving rainStrong when correctly installedModerate — seams and gaps are vulnerable pointsVariable — dependent on maintenance and coatings
Salt air / corrosion exposureNon-combustible cement board; needs corrosion-resistant fastenersPlastic doesn't corrode but can become brittle over timeFasteners and hardware corrode; wood weathers unevenly
Finish longevityFactory ColorPlus finish, long-lastingColor molded in, can fadeNeeds repainting or restaining on a recurring cycle
Moss/algae resistanceGood; growth stays surface-levelSimilar surface growth possibleGrowth can trap moisture against substrate
Fire resistanceNon-combustibleCombustible, can melt/deformCombustible

What to Check Before You Hire Any Siding Contractor

  • Do they specify the correct James Hardie climate line (HZ5) for this region, or a generic product?
  • Will they show you the weather-resistive barrier and flashing plan before siding goes up, not just after?
  • Do they use manufacturer-specified fasteners and corrosion-resistant hardware given the salt air here?
  • Can they explain how they'll handle clearance at grade, decks, and rooflines on your specific house?
  • Do they have a plan for protecting the wall assembly if it rains mid-project?
  • Is the estimate written, itemized, and clear about what's included — trim, flashing, disposal, permits?

What's the difference between Hardie's HZ5 and HZ10 product lines?

Hardie engineers its siding for different climate zones, and HZ5 is formulated for wetter, more moderate climates like ours in the Pacific Northwest, while HZ10 is built for hotter, drier, more UV-intense regions. Using the wrong zone product for your climate can affect long-term performance, which is why we specify HZ5 for Blaine and Ferndale homes.

Does salt air near the water actually shorten the life of siding?

Salt-laden air accelerates corrosion on metal fasteners, flashing, and trim hardware, and it can also degrade lower-quality finishes faster than an inland environment would. It's a real factor in material and hardware choices for any home near Blaine's shoreline, which is part of why we use corrosion-resistant fasteners and a factory-cured finish rather than field-applied paint.
